使用美国VPS搭建视频网站:高带宽选型与配置指南
文章分类:技术文档 /
创建时间:2025-08-06
想搭建流畅稳定的视频网站?美国VPS凭借高带宽优势成为优选——其覆盖全球的网络节点、弹性可扩的带宽资源,能有效解决视频加载卡顿、跨区域播放延迟等问题。本文将从服务器选型、配置实操到运营注意事项,为你拆解高带宽美国VPS的使用要点。
高带宽美国VPS的选型逻辑
视频网站的核心体验是“流畅播放”,这直接依赖服务器的带宽能力。根据实际运营数据,一个日均10万独立访客的视频网站,若80%用户同时观看720P视频(单流约2Mbps),总带宽需求需达到160Mbps以上——这正是高带宽美国VPS的用武之地。
选型时需重点关注三个维度:
- 带宽大小与计费模式:优先选择“峰值带宽”明确的套餐(如100Mbps-1Gbps可选),避免“共享带宽”导致高峰拥堵。部分服务商提供“按实际使用量计费”选项,适合初期流量不稳定的站点。
- 稳定性保障:查看服务商的SLA(服务等级协议),99.9%以上的可用性意味着年停机时间不超过8.76小时。可通过第三方监控平台(如UptimeRobot)核查历史稳定性数据。
- 存储与IO性能:视频文件多为大尺寸(1080P视频每小时约5-8GB),建议选择SSD硬盘(读写速度超传统HDD3倍)的美国VPS。以存储1000小时1080P视频为例,需至少5TB SSD空间,同时注意IOPS(输入输出每秒)需≥5000,避免文件读取延迟。
从系统到应用的配置实操
选定美国VPS后,配置环节直接影响视频分发效率。以下是关键步骤:
第一步:操作系统与基础优化
推荐选择CentOS 8或Ubuntu 20.04 LTS——前者适合熟悉RPM包管理的用户,后者对Docker等容器工具支持更友好。系统安装完成后,需执行基础优化:
更新系统补丁
sudo apt update && sudo apt upgrade -y
关闭不必要服务(如蓝牙、打印服务)
systemctl disable bluetooth cups
第二步:部署Web与流媒体服务器
- Web服务器首选Nginx(相比Apache内存占用低30%),通过`/etc/nginx/nginx.conf`配置反向代理,将静态资源(封面图、简介)与流媒体分离,减少主进程压力。
- 流媒体服务器推荐SRS(Simple Realtime Server),作为开源方案其延迟可控制在1秒内。安装后修改`conf/srs.conf`:
vhost __defaultVhost__ {
http_remux {
enabled on;
mount [vhost]/[app]/[stream].flv;
}
}
此配置可将RTMP流转换为HTTP-FLV,适配更多播放器。
第三步:数据库与缓存配置
视频元数据(标题、标签、播放量)建议存储于MySQL 8.0+,通过InnoDB引擎保障事务安全。为提升查询速度,可搭配Redis缓存高频访问数据(如“热门视频列表”),缓存失效时间设为30分钟,平衡实时性与性能。
运营阶段的三大注意事项
网站上线后,持续优化才能保持体验:
- 网络安全加固:通过`ufw`防火墙仅开放必要端口(80/443用于HTTP/HTTPS,1935用于RTMP),定期使用`fail2ban`拦截暴力破解请求。重要数据(如用户评论)建议启用AES-256加密存储。
- 版权合规管理:建立视频上传审核流程,要求上传者提供版权证明(如CC协议授权书)。对用户生成内容(UGC),可接入第三方版权检测API(如百度文心大模型的版权识别服务)。
- 性能监控与扩容:每日通过`htop`查看CPU/内存使用率,`nload`监控带宽占用。当CPU持续超过70%或带宽利用率超80%时,及时联系服务商升级美国VPS配置(如增加核心数、扩展带宽)。
使用美国VPS搭建视频网站,本质是通过高带宽资源与合理配置,将“技术能力”转化为“用户体验”。从选型时的参数对比,到配置中的细节调优,再到运营期的持续维护,每个环节都需结合实际流量特征灵活调整——掌握这些要点,你也能打造出用户点赞的优质视频平台。